How do I run a MySQL query in Python?

How do I run a MySQL query in Python?

Steps to fetch rows from a MySQL database table

  1. Connect to MySQL from Python.
  2. Define a SQL SELECT Query.
  3. Get Cursor Object from Connection.
  4. Execute the SELECT query using execute() method.
  5. Extract all rows from a result.
  6. Iterate each row.
  7. Close the cursor object and database connection object.

Can Python interact with MySQL?

MySQL server will provide all the services required for handling your database. Once the server is up and running, you can connect your Python application with it using MySQL Connector/Python.

How do I query a SQL database in Python?

Steps to Connect Python to SQL Server using pyodbc

  1. Step 1: Install pyodbc. First, you’ll need to install the pyodbc package which will be used to connect Python to SQL Server.
  2. Step 2: Retrieve the server name.
  3. Step 3: Obtain the database name.
  4. Step 4: Get the table name.
  5. Step 5: Connect Python to SQL Server.

Which version of Python is needed for the MySQL Python connector?

Python 8.0
MySQL Connector/Python 8.0 is highly recommended for use with MySQL Server 8.0, 5.7 and 5.6.

What should be used as first statement to connect to MySQL?

To access and add content to a MySQL database, you must first establish a connection between the database and a PHP script. In this tutorial, learn how to use MySQLi Extension and PHP Data Objects to connect to MySQL.

Which is best database for Python?

SQLite is likely the most clear database to connect with a Python application since you don’t have to install any external Python SQL database modules. As a matter of course, your Python installation contains a Python SQL library named SQLite3 that you can utilize to connect and interact with a SQLite database.

What is MySQL connector Python?

MySQL Connector/Python enables Python programs to access MySQL databases, using an API that is compliant with the Python Database API Specification v2. MySQL Connector/Python includes support for: Almost all features provided by MySQL Server up to and including MySQL Server version 8.0.

How do I know if MySQL connector is installed?

Type import mysql. connector and execute the program. If it is executed successfully mean installation completed successfully. Also, you can check that MySQL Connector Python installation is working and able to connect to MySQL Server by Connecting to MySQL Using MySQL Connector Python.

Can a Python program query a MySQL database?

I want a simple python program to prompt the user for a title and search a mySQL database. I have the database constructed but I can’t figure out how to query it properly.

How to use MySQL Connector in Python 3?

For Python 3 or higher version install using pip3 as: To test MySQL database connectivity in Python here, we will use pre-installed MySQL connector and pass credentials into connect () function like host, username and password as shown in the below Python MySQL connector example. Syntax to access MySQL with Python:

How is a cursor created in MySQL Connector?

It executes the query in the server via the connection. We use the cursor method on our connection object to create a cursor object (MySQL Connector uses an object-oriented programming paradigm, so there are lots of objects inheriting properties from parent objects).

What kind of operating system does MySQL use?

MySQL is available for all major operating systems, including Windows, macOS, Linux, and Solaris. Speed: MySQL holds a reputation for being an exceedingly fast database solution. It has a relatively smaller footprint and is extremely scalable in the long run.